How they compare

Nicaragua currently reports 8.0% against 7.9% in Burundi, a difference of 0.1%.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 40 shared years of data; in 1985 it was Burundi ahead.

Burundi ranks 143rd and Nicaragua ranks 141st of 198 countries.

Burundi has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Burundi Nicaragua Difference Ahead
1980s 50.9% 20.4% 30.5% Burundi
1990s 43.2% 15.8% 27.4% Burundi
2000s 27.9% 7.7% 20.2% Burundi
2010s 11.0% 4.5% 6.5% Burundi
2020s 9.3% 6.4% 2.9% Burundi

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Transport is the process of carriage of people and objects from one location to another as well as related supporting and auxiliary services. Also included are postal and courier services. This indicator is expressed as a percentage of service exports which are commercial services provided by residents to non-residents.
